Uruguayan vs Immigrants from Armenia Unemployment Among Ages 55 to 59 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 141,180,738 people shows a strong positive correlation between the proportion of Uruguayans and unemployment rate among population between the ages 55 and 59 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.730 and weighted average of 4.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 96,295,490 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Armenia and unemployment rate among population between the ages 55 and 59 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.364 and weighted average of 6.0%, a difference of 24.5%.
